World Series By Renault – António Félix da Costa wins Race1 at Catalunya, Spain

Portuguese Red Bull’s Young Driver Programme António Félix da Costa won today his third race in World Series By Renault 3.5. , a category that has allowed in the past  several drivers to pave their way to Formula 1.

Félix da Costa won the race with almost a 4 seconds advantage over Sam Bird. This is Félix da Costa third win within the last 4 races (and he finished 2nd in the other one). With this win he went up to 4th position in the World Championship. Although he will be unable to reach the title since the last race will be held tomorrow also in Catalunya, Félix da Costa is definitely the best driver in this category.

Had he started the season in World Series By Renault – he was involved in GP3 championship and failed to start the first 5 races of World Series By Renault (there are a total of 18 races in the season) – and surely we would end up as Champion. Félix da Costa is just 48 points behind the current championship leader that took part in all races (25 points for a win in each race).

Félix da Costa is therefore the pilot with more points gained per race ran.
